Pr₃In₁O₁ is a rare-earth indium oxide compound, a member of the mixed-metal oxide semiconductor family with potential electronic and photonic applications. This material is primarily investigated in research contexts for its unique electronic structure combining praseodymium and indium, which influences charge transport and optical properties relative to conventional binary oxides. Applications of this material class are emerging in advanced electronics, optoelectronics, and functional coatings where rare-earth dopants provide enhanced performance or novel functionality.
